The latest batch of Oscar nominations will be revealed tomorrow, and that can only mean one thing: Razzies today! Yes, the awards that honor dubious achievements in the world of cinema have announced their latest batch of contenders for that most coveted of prizes, the Golden Raspberry. Unsurprisingly, Basic Instinct 2 and Little Man led the pack with seven nominations each, but shockingly, Lucky Number Slevin was left out of the mix entirely.

Noteworthy this year was also the exclusion of Sylvester Stallone and Rocky Balboa, both of which seemed destined for a Razzie sweep in November, but Razzies founder John Wilson told the AP, “At the first of the year, you could not have convinced me it wasn’t going to be a Razzie contender. I would like to publicly say that Stallone has made a good movie.”

For the complete list of nominees, click after the jump:Worst Picture
Basic Instinct 2
Little Man
Wicker Man
Lady in the Water
BloodRayne

Worst Actor
Tim Allen, The Santa Clause 3: The Escape Clause, The Shaggy Dog, Zoom
Nicolas Cage, Wicker Man
Larry the Cable Guy, Larry the Cable Guy: Health Inspector
Rob Schneider, Benchwarmers, Little Man
Shawn & Marlon Wayans, Little Man

Worst Actress
Hilary and Haylie Duff, Material Girls
Sharon Stone, Basic Instinct 2
Lindsay Lohan, Just My Luck
Kristanna Loken, BloodRayne
Jessica Simpson, Employee of the Month

Worst Supporting Actor
Danny DeVito, Deck the Halls
Ben Kingsley, BloodRayne
M. Night Shyamalan, Lady in the Water
Martin Short, The Santa Clause 3: The Escape Clause
David Thewlis, Basic Instinct 2, The Omen

Worst Supporting Actress
Kate Bosworth, Superman Returns
Kristin Chenoweth, Deck the Halls, Pink Panther, RV
Carmen Electra, Date Movie, Scary Movie 4
Jenny McCarthy, John Tucker Must Die
Michelle Rodriguez, BloodRayne

Worst Screen Couple
Tim Allen & Martin Short, The Santa Clause 3: The Escape Clause
Nicolas Cage & His Bear Suit, Wicker Man
Hilary & Haylie Duff, Material Girls
Sharon Stone’s Lopsided Breasts, Basic Instinct 2
Shawn Wayans and either Kerry Washington or Marlon Wayans, Little Man

Worst Remake or Rip-Off
Little Man (Rip-off of the 1954 Bugs Bunny Cartoon, Baby Buggy Bunny)
Pink Panther
Poseidon
The Shaggy Dog Story
Wicker Man

Worst Prequel or Sequel
Basic Instinct 2
Big Momma’s House 2
Garfield 2: A Tail of Two Kitties
The Santa Clause 3: The Escape Clause
Texas Chainsaw Massacre: The Beginning

Worst Director
Uwe Boll, BloodRayne
Michael Caton-Jones, Basic Instinct 2
Ron Howard, The Da Vinci Code
M. Night Shyamalan, Lady in the Water
Keenan Ivory Wayans, Little Man

Worst Screenplay
Basic Instinct 2
BloodRayne
Lady in the Water
Little Man
Wicker Man

Worst Excuse for Family Entertainment (New Category!)
Deck the Halls
Garfield 2: A Tail of Two Kitties
RV
The Santa Clause 3: The Escape Clause
The Shaggy Dog
